DEUTÉRONOME 5:14
Mais le septième jour est le jour du repos de l’Éternel, ton Dieu: tu ne feras aucun ouvrage, ni toi, ni ton fils, ni ta fille, ni ton serviteur, ni ta servante, ni ton bœuf, ni ton âne, ni aucune de tes bêtes, ni l’étranger qui est dans tes portes, afin que ton serviteur et ta servante se reposent comme toi.This verse in the real world
